THIMPHU – Police in Wangdue have detained a 24-year-old monk on charges of raping a 15-year-old girl, a student from a school in Gasa.
According to police, the suspect and the minor became acquainted through Facebook more than a year ago. The two reportedly began communicating on social media in October last year before later meeting in Wangdue, where they are alleged to have engaged in sexual intercourse.
The case came to light after the girl was found to be pregnant. During the investigation, the minor informed police that the monk was the father of the child. The suspect has also reportedly admitted to knowing the girl.
Under the Penal Code, a person is guilty of raping a child above 12 years if they engage in sexual intercourse with a child between the ages of 12 and 18. The offence is classified as a second-degree felony under the Penal Code (Amendment) Act of Bhutan 2011.
If convicted, the suspect faces a prison sentence ranging from nine to 15 years.
